Abstract

The application of ion-selective electrodes (ISE) with ionophore-based membranes under galvanostatic polarization conditions is briefly reviewed. The possibilities offered by polarization for expanding the working range of ISE and for varying their selectivity and the type of electrode response (cationic or anionic) are discussed.
